The Treasure is Selma Lagerlöf's dark, concentrated tale of crime, haunting, and moral reckoning, better known in Swedish as Sir Arne's Treasure. Set in a wintry sixteenth-century Scandinavian borderland, it follows the aftermath of a brutal massacre committed for gold, and the tragic entanglement of the surviving Elsalill with one of the murderers. Lagerlöf fuses historical romance, Gothic suspense, folk ballad, and saga-like fatalism, creating a narrative at once starkly simple and symbolically rich. Selma Lagerlöf, the first woman to receive the Nobel Prize in Literature, drew deeply on Swedish oral tradition, provincial memory, and Lutheran moral culture. Born in Värmland in 1858, she transformed regional legend into modern literary art, combining realism with the supernatural. Her interest in guilt, compassion, and spiritual justice shapes this novella, whose ghostly elements express not fantasy alone but an ethical order pressing upon human weakness. Herbert West-Reanimator is H. P. Lovecraft's mordant, episodic tale of scientific transgression, in which a brilliant medical student pursues the restoration of life with increasingly monstrous results. First serialized in 1922, the work recasts the Frankenstein inheritance through the brisk, lurid energies of pulp fiction. Its style is clinical, repetitive, and accumulative, using report-like narration to intensify dread while anticipating later traditions of body horror and zombie literature. Lovecraft, a central figure in American weird fiction, was deeply preoccupied with forbidden knowledge, human insignificance, and the collapse of rational confidence. Though better known for cosmic horror, here he turns toward the grotesque consequences of materialist science. His fascination with anatomy, decay, and intellectual obsession informs Herbert West, whose cold ambition reflects Lovecraft's recurring suspicion that inquiry may reveal truths humanity is unfit to bear. This book is recommended to readers interested in the darker genealogy of modern horror. While less philosophically vast than Lovecraft's later masterpieces, it is essential for understanding his development, his engagement with Gothic precedent, and his influence on twentieth-century popular terror.

Perhaps no figure better embodies the transition from the Gothic tradition to modern horror than Arthur Machen. In the final decade of the nineteenth century, the Welsh writer produced a seminal body of tales of occult horror, spiritual and physical corruption, and malignant survivals from the primeval past which horrified and scandalised-late-Victorian readers. Machen's 'weird fiction' has influenced generations of storytellers, from H. P. Lovecraft to Guillermo Del Toro-and it remains no less unsettling today. This new collection, which includes the complete novel The Three Impostors as well as such celebrated tales as The Great God Pan and The White People, constitutes the most comprehensive critical edition of Machen yet to appear. In addition to the core late-Victorian horror classics, a selection of lesser-known prose poems and later tales helps to present a fuller picture of the development of Machen's weird vision. The edition's introduction and notes contextualise the life and work of this foundational figure in the history of horror.

Dracula is a novel by Bram Stoker, published in 1897. An epistolary novel, the narrative is related through letters, diary entries, and newspaper articles. It has no single protagonist, but opens with solicitor Jonathan Harker taking a business trip to stay at the castle of a Transylvanian nobleman, Count Dracula. Harker escapes the castle after discovering that Dracula is a vampire, and the Count moves to England and plagues the seaside town of Whitby. A small group, led by Abraham Van Helsing, hunt Dracula and, in the end, kill him. Dracula was mostly written in the 1890s. Stoker produced over a hundred pages of notes for the novel, drawing extensively from Transylvanian folklore and history. Some scholars have suggested that the character of Dracula was inspired by historical figures like the Wallachian prince Vlad the Impaler or the countess Elizabeth Báthory, but there is widespread disagreement. Stoker's notes mention neither figure. He found the name Dracula in Whitby's public library while holidaying there, picking it because he thought it meant devil in Romanian. Following its publication, Dracula was positively received by reviewers who pointed to its effective use of horror. In contrast, reviewers who wrote negatively of the novel regarded it as excessively frightening. Comparisons to other works of Gothic fiction were common, including its structural similarity to Wilkie Collins' The Woman in White (1859). In the past century, Dracula has been situated as a piece of Gothic fiction. Modern scholars explore the novel within its historical context-the Victorian era-and discuss its depiction of gender roles, sexuality, and race. Dracula is one of the most famous pieces of English literature. Many of the book's characters have entered popular culture as archetypal versions of their characters; for example, Count Dracula as the quintessential vampire, and Abraham Van Helsing as an iconic vampire hunter. The novel, which is in the public domain, has been adapted for film over 30 times, and its characters have made numerous appearances in virtually all media. (wikipedia.org) About the author: Abraham Stoker (8 November 1847 - 20 April 1912) was an Irish author who wrote the 1897 Gothic horror novel Dracula. During his lifetime, he was better known as the personal assistant of actor Sir Henry Irving and business manager of the West End's Lyceum Theatre, which Irving owned. In his early years, Stoker worked as a theatre critic for an Irish newspaper, and wrote stories as well as commentaries. He also enjoyed travelling, particularly to Cruden Bay where he set two of his novels. During another visit to the English coastal town of Whitby, Stoker drew inspiration for writing Dracula. He died on 20 April 1912 due to locomotor ataxia and was cremated in north London. Since his death, his magnum opus Dracula has become one of the most well-known works in English literature, and the novel has been adapted for numerous films, short stories, and plays. Before Dracula there was Carmilla, the queen of the sapphic vampires, created by the Irish author J.S. Le Fanu. Carmilla (1872) is a landmark in vampire fiction, the character portrayed in numerous horror films, most notably Hammer's The Vampire Lovers. The similarities between Carmilla and Bram Stoker's Dracula (1897) are striking, with Le Fanu's Baron Vordenburg anticipating Stoker's Van Helsing, while Carmilla is another undead sexually magnetic aristocrat posing as a descendant of herself. Le Fanu was a Victorian master of gothic, mystery, and supernatural fiction, and the father of the modern ghost story. As M.R. James wrote of him, 'I do not think that there are better ghost stories anywhere than the best of Le Fanu's.' This collection brings together Le Fanu's greatest short stories, full of horror, intrigue, Irish folklore, and gallows humour, all building towards his masterpiece, Carmilla, the chilling tale of a beautiful girl who came to stay... There are also explanatory notes, original publication details, suggested reading, an original introduction, and an essay on Le Fanu by his admirer and natural heir, M.R. James.
